18 Hill Street - Inverness Holiday Rental in Crown
Welcome to Inverness, The capital of the Highlands. The historic town, now bustling city, sits where the River Ness meets the Moray Firth. From the moment you step into the city you feel the weight of Scottish history all around. The historic town is framed by the mountains and lochs that have drawn travellers north for centuries. 18 Hill Street is your home from home in the middle of it all, tucked into the leafy Crown area, one of the most desirable residential areas in the city.
Crown is a quiet, characterful neighbourhood of handsome Victorian houses just up the hill from the city centre. The area boasts its own delicatessen, two cafes and two pubs all popular with locals and visitors alike.
You are only minutes on foot from the heart of Inverness. Wander down to the newly renovated Inverness Castle, stroll along the banks of the River Ness, or cross the elegant footbridges to the Ness Islands for a peaceful walk among the trees. The twin spires of St Andrew's Cathedral, the bustling Victorian Market, and some of the finest restaurants, whisky bars and pubs in the Highlands are all within easy reach.
The house itself has two comfortable bedrooms, both fitted with versatile zip and link beds. That means you can have a generous kingsize for couples, or split the beds into two singles for friends or family travelling together. Whichever way you choose, the rooms are dressed with crisp linens and soft furnishings designed to feel like a proper Scottish welcome after a day of exploring.
With a well equipped modern kitchen and a cosy living space, you have everything you need to make a hearty breakfast before setting off, or to settle in with a dram and a good book once the day is done.
One of the real joys of 18 Hill Street is the private garden. It is a peaceful little corner of your own, with lovely views over the surrounding rooftops. It is the perfect spot for a morning coffee as you plan your day, or a quiet glass of wine in the evening after a day of exploring.
For those drawn to Scotland by its history and legends, Hill Street puts you in the perfect launchpad. The mysterious shores of Loch Ness are just twenty minutes away, where you can take a boat trip in search of Nessie, visit the dramatic ruins of Urquhart Castle, or simply stand and stare across waters that have inspired stories for centuries. The haunting Culloden Battlefield, where the 1746 Jacobite rising came to its tragic end, is a short drive in the other direction, followed closely by the ancient Clava Cairns, a circle of standing stones older than the pyramids.
Whisky lovers will find themselves on the doorstep of Speyside, the most famous distilling region in the world, home to legendary names like Glenfiddich, Macallan, Glenlivet and Aberlour. A day spent following the Malt Whisky Trail is a quintessential Scottish experience and one many of our guests return home talking about.
Beyond that, the wider Highlands open up in every direction. You can be in the Cairngorms National Park within an hour, on the wild beaches of the north coast, or following the road to the Isle of Skye, all from this one perfectly placed base. Whether you are here for the castles, the clans, the whisky, the wildlife or simply the unforgettable Highland scenery, 18 Hill Street offers the warmth, comfort and character of a true Scottish home.
If you require single beds, this must be requested prior to arrival.
